> Intro:
> This program is intended to provide to radios or webradios actors, _a
> simple way_ to send their live audio to one or many streaming server.

> Robinet package contains:
> - the python main program file.
> - the glade UI definition file
> - the liquidsoap script designed especially for robinet
> - some images
>
> Requirements:
> To run the software, of course you'll need a working copy of liquidsoap
> which should be compiled according to the .liq script requirements
> (mp3...). Also, remember that robinet uses relatively recent features
> like dynamic sources etc.
>
> Robinet actually uses pulse as input device to create the source. It
> means that liquidsoap will connect to the local pulse daemon every time
> a new playlist (ie: a "stream link") is dynamically added.
